Output 7f21a8052026aa8b4f8f5e6baf08ffeeb3c60c51aae5cffa81de697ebd6b6e29:0

value
21272573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d3f89c77dd18c5415f1d4412d5189323817089a OP_EQUALVERIFY OP_CHECKSIG
address
19W3xZ1BPUjDehLCqcrr5EcQ523pfbgMrd
transaction
7f21a8052026aa8b4f8f5e6baf08ffeeb3c60c51aae5cffa81de697ebd6b6e29
spent
true